  • Patent number: 10067228
    Abstract: A sonar survey system and method excites reflectors using a broadband message that excites all frequencies within the band providing for selection and evaluation of frequencies of interest after the survey is completed.
    Type: Grant
    Filed: September 11, 2017
    Date of Patent: September 4, 2018
    Assignee: R2SONIC, LLC
    Inventors: Jens Steenstrup, Christopher Tiemann, Peter Bilodeau, Mark Chun, Kirk Hobart
